ST. PAUL, Neb. (AP) – A Howard County commissioner has been fined for taking campaign signs from a yard in St. Paul. Lauren Scarborough pleaded no contest on Wednesday to misdemeanor theft. Spokesman Allen Forkner of the Nebraska attorney general’s office said Scarborough was fined $500. The attorney general’s office handled the case because Howard County Attorney Bob Sivick declared that it would have been a conflict of interest for him to prosecute. Burwell Company Faces Fines
A Burwell company faces $293,000 in fines for safety violations at its grain-handling facility. The Occupational Safety and Health Administration announced Wednesday that it has cited Loup Valley Alfalfa Inc. for 26 violations stemming from a December inspection. OSHA says the violations include failure to provide fall protection on open-sided platforms and operation of mechanical equipment while workers were in the grain bin, among others. Railroad worker who fell into river still missing
NORFOLK, Neb. (AP) – Officials had not yet found a man who fell into the raging Elkhorn River after a railroad bridge collapsed. Norfolk Fire Chief Shane Weidner said Wednesday that air searches were being done because the area was too dangerous to search on the ground or by boat. Water spills over, but dam mostly holds
by The Grand Island Independent SPALDING — Stories of dam breaks and bridge failures spread around Spalding Monday as residents watch to see if their dam would hold. The town, which has received 17 inches of rain since Memorial Day, is downstream on the Cedar River from the Ericson Reservoir in Wheeler County.
